This is called a structured reference formula, which is unique to ... WebFeb 28, 2024 · The planar spatial data type, geometry, represents data in a Euclidean (flat) coordinate system. This type is implemented as a common language runtime (CLR) data type in SQL Server. The geometry type is predefined and available in each database. Algebra 1 On Reference Sheet On Reference … WebA shape column in each row is used to hold the geometry or shape of each feature. In the feature class table, the following are true: Each feature class is a table. Individual features are held as rows. Feature attributes are recorded in columns. The shape column holds each feature's geometry (point, line, polygon, and so forth).
